Veterans' Disability Benefits

Mesothelioma Lawyers who are VA-accredited can help veterans pursue compensation claims arising from service-related disabilities. Veterans diagnosed with mesothelioma as well as other asbestos-related diseases may be eligible for a variety of VA benefits. These programs can assist in paying treatment costs.

Asbestos was utilized in all branches of the military between the 1930s and the 1980s before its dangers were fully appreciated. It was commonly used in ships, equipment and bases to provide fireproofing, heat resistance and durability. This exposure put veterans at risk of developing mesothelioma or another asbestos-related illness later in life.

Veterans are the largest group of mesothelioma victims in the United States, accounting for around one-third of all diagnoses. Fortunately that the VA provides a variety of compensation programs to help patients receive life-saving treatment.

Disability compensation is a monthly payment that is tax-free. It can aid mesothelioma sufferers as well as their families with expenses for living. The VA offers health insurance that covers routine checkups and specialist appointments, as well as other treatments. A majority of the top mesothelioma specialists in the country work at VA hospitals. The VA can also refer patients with mesothelioma to civilian doctors, who are paid by the VA.

Veterans may also be eligible for burial and funeral costs through the VA Dependency and Indemnity Compensation program (DIC). This can assist with expenses relating to the death of a spouse of a veteran.

When a mesothelioma patient needs to travel to receive treatment and treatment, the VA can assist with accommodation and airfare. The VA has a Veterans Choice program that allows veterans to receive medical treatment outside the VA system, if that is more practical.

A mesothelioma patient has to have a documented asbestos exposure as well as a mesothelioma diagnosis to be eligible for VA disability compensation. It is important to remember, too, that the VA claim should not be filed in place of a personal injury lawsuit against the asbestos-related companies responsible for exposure. It is better to pursue both claims simultaneously. A reputable mesothelioma lawyer can help with both types of claims.

Treatment Grants

The cost of mesothelioma treatment can be overwhelming, and it's common for patients to receive hundreds of thousands of dollars worth of treatment. For victims who do not have health insurance, they could be unable to pay for their medical bills. There are options to cover the cost of mesothelioma care. Many charities have set up programs that offer financial assistance for mesothelioma patients. These grants can help pay for costs such as medication transport to and from treatment and accommodation while in hospital.

Attorneys can also offer financial aid to asbestos sufferers. A mesothelioma attorney can assist victims in receiving compensation from asbestos trust fund as well as other legal compensation sources. Attorneys will review the patient's exposure details along with medical history and other related factors to determine possible compensation amounts.

Researchers are trying to raise funds for mesothelioma cancer research. The cancer is not well-publicized and the government allocates mesothelioma a smaller amount of money than other cancers. Mesothelioma patients and advocates fight for increased federal funding. For instance in 2009, four mesothelioma research grant awards were awarded to top doctors like Thoracic surgeon Dr. Harvey Pass and thoracic oncologist Dr. Courtney Broaddus. The mesothelioma research funding increased after activists convinced the Department of Defense of the need to join the cause.

Many mesothelioma patients can receive free or low-cost treatment when they participate in a clinical trial. These trials are research studies on experimental treatments that aren't yet accessible to the general public. Patients may be eligible for travel grants to pay for the cost of transportation to visit a mesothelioma expert.

Some states also have health programs to help patients with medical expenses. For instance the Health Resources and Services Administration (HRSA)'s Bureau of Primary Health Care gives money to medical centers that offer health care for patients with low incomes. Health Insurance

Many mesothelioma patients have private health insurance plans which pay for some of their medical expenses. Other patients can avail government-funded programs, such as Medicare and Social Security Disability Insurance. These programs can help families receive the financial assistance they require to get treatment.

Mesothelioma patients and their families may be eligible for compensation via asbestos trust funds, wrongful-death lawsuits or workers compensation claims. Most states' statutes of limitations for mesothelioma lawsuits range from 2-3 years. However, these deadlines begin at the time of diagnosis or the date of death, whichever occurs first. This means that patients who are diagnosed with mesothelioma must seek legal advice as soon as is possible.

Asbestos sufferers should be aware of whether they qualify for compensation claims through the employer's workers' comp or disability scheme. These schemes will pay for medical examinations and treatments as well as assist with living expenses.

Mesothelioma sufferers and their families should look into the possibility of pursuing a legal action through the mesothelioma trust fund of the company responsible for their exposure to asbestos. These trust funds provide an efficient and speedy way to recover compensation without going to court.

Trust Funds

Patients with mesothelioma are eligible for compensation from several different funds. They could be eligible for a claim through an asbestos trust fund or a lawsuit, or a settlement. Trust funds are subject to specific requirements, lawsuits and settlements are more flexible in regards to the amount of damages awarded. Asbestos lawyers can help you determine the best method to get compensation.

Asbestos Trust Funds are money pools created by companies to pay asbestos victims. To be eligible for a trust-fund payout asbestos victims must present proof of their mesothelioma. This includes medical records, work history and other evidence. Lawyers can help clients in gathering this information and preparing it for filing.

Asbestos lawsuits and trust fund claims are distinct from one another, but the two methods can be combined to maximize the financial compensation a victim receives. Lawsuits can be filed against multiple defendants, and victims often receive more than one award. Mesothelioma lawsuits may also award victims a greater amount of economic damages.
